Posted on

return multiple table from function in sql server

3. inline table valued functions. Rolling up data from multiple rows into a single row may be necessary for concatenating data, reporting, exchanging data between systems and more. Basically a Table-Valued Function is a function that returns a table, thus it can be used as a table in a query. It can still return multiple columns and multiple rows, but it does so with a single query. When you run code in SQL server, several things have to happen. Preparing the Data A scalar valued function may be invoked as part of a SELECT clause (like your example) to return a singe value whereas a table-valued function must be specified in a FROM (or JOIN) clause to return rows containing multiple columns. Returning multiple values from a UDF can be done fairly easily in SQL Server, but we must return those values as a virtual table. That’s true, partly. Function to return multiple values in SQL SERVER [Answered] RSS. Table-Valued Functions have been around since SQL Server version 2005. Function to return multiple values in SQL SERVER. It looks like you are calling a scalar function rather than a table-valued one. In this article we’re going to take a look at the functions that return table type data - Inline Table-Valued functions and Multi-statement Table-Valued Functions (MSTVF). How to Rollup Multiple Rows into a Single Row in SQL Server. Dec 19, 2013 My overarching goal is to generate sets of random Symptom records for each Enrollee in a drug study, so that for each cycle (period of time), the code will insert a random number of random records for each enrollee. SQL Server 2012 :: Return Random Records In A Table-valued Function? hi guys. As a part of the SQL Server programming language, you can create user defined functions which are routines that accept different parameters to perform calculations and return the value based on the action performed. This can be accomplished by: The solution proposed in this tip explores two SQL Server commands that can help us achieve the expected results. Reply; shmail Member. In this article, we explored why we should use functions in SQL Server and then learned the usage scenarios of the inline table-valued functions (iTVF). User Defined Functions can return scalar values or table type data. Feb 12, 2018 10:19 AM | shmail | LINK. The RETURN exits the stored procedure, and nothing that follows it will be executed, including the SELECT statement on the following line. The following very simple ParseEmail() function accepts an email address as an argument, parses it, and returns the … 130 Posts. Before you try something new please take care that your SQL Server is properly backed up. These types of functions make our database development process easier and modular and also, they help to avoid re-write the same code again. There are different types of functions supported in SQL Server: User Defined Functions and built in System Functions. Assuming you're using SQL Server 2005 or later, and you only want the details of the newly-inserted record, the OUTPUT Clause would probably be the simplest option: First sounds like nothing new since a view has been an available mechanism for a much longer time. i want to get two result from one fuction. 45 Points. My example of this query fits in to this category. In previous posts I explained SQL Server difference between view and stored procedure, SQL Server split function example to split comma separated string, SQL Server update statement with inner joins, interview questions in asp.net, sql server, c# and many articles relating to SQL Server.Now I will explain how SQL Server function will return multiple values in SQL Server … with inline table valued functions, there is only 1 tsql statement within it. The return table (@ResultTable) contains ProductName, ScrapQty, ScrapReasonDef, and ScrapStatus columns and this table will be populated and updated in the function body according to the parameter … In the above function, we declared a parameter (@ScrapComLevel).According to this parameter, the scrap quantity status determined as critical or normal.

Craig Of The Creek Bernard, 3-function Switch For Bathroom Fan, History Of Osun Osogbo Festival Pdf, Remnant Ixillis Alternate Kill, Moen Vs Hansgrohe, Aesthetic Minecraft Mods For Mobile, How To Access Heavensward Content, Beaba Water Level Chart, Data Scientist Contractor Salary, Vida And Ryan Truth Or Drink Instagram, Action Army Aap-01 Assassin,

Leave a Reply

Your email address will not be published. Required fields are marked *